On 2005-11-02, DaveL AKA wrote:
I have a new cd player which is HDCD compatible. It turns out that I only have one HDCD disk in my entire cd collection and it sounds awesome. I was thinking about buying some more hdcd disks. It's not easy tracking these down. I see some on ebay from China. Anybody ever tried these? Do they suck? I have this idea that they are simply regular CDs that the Chinese have bootlegged. DaveL For jazz, Narada Jazz puts out HDCDs for Keiko Matsui's recordings; a couple may not be labeled as "HDCD" but they are since I had to switch to the alternate input for analogue. Be aware that if you change your receiver and/or player, you might have to connect both the digital & analogue output from the player; the analogue out may have to be connected to another input of the receiver. |
